The textbook "History of the Middle Ages" by Brandt is a cornerstone of the 6th-grade history curriculum in many Russian schools. It serves as a bridge between the ancient world and the early modern era, introducing students to a thousand years of transformative human history. While the textbook itself is the primary source of knowledge, many students frequently turn to "GDZ" (Gotovye Domashnie Zadaniya, or Ready Homework Answers) to navigate the complexities of the period. While GDZ offers quick answers, the true value of studying Brandt’s "History of the Middle Ages" lies in the process of discovery. Relying solely on pre-written answers can prevent a student from developing historical empathy—the ability to understand why people in the 12th century acted the way they did.
